ITPub博客

首页 > Linux操作系统 > Linux操作系统 > ORA-00600: internal error code, arguments: [2103]错误

ORA-00600: internal error code, arguments: [2103]错误

原创 Linux操作系统 作者:cjyhappy 时间:2009-08-04 08:42:14 0 删除 编辑

一、alert_sid.log出现ORA-00600错误

Starting background process MMON

Sun May 31 07:21:14 2009

Starting background process MMON

Sun May 31 07:26:34 2009

Starting background process MMON

Sun May 31 07:31:54 2009

Starting background process MMON

Sun May 31 07:37:14 2009

Starting background process MMON

Sun May 31 07:42:34 2009

Starting background process MMON

Sun May 31 07:47:54 2009

Starting background process MMON

Sun May 31 07:53:14 2009

Starting background process MMON

Sun May 31 07:58:34 2009

Starting background process MMON

Sun May 31 08:03:54 2009

Starting background process MMON

Sun May 31 08:09:14 2009

Starting background process MMON

Sun May 31 08:14:34 2009

Starting background process MMON

Sun May 31 08:17:42 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

Sun May 31 08:19:54 2009

Starting background process MMON

Sun May 31 08:25:14 2009

Starting background process MMON

Sun May 31 08:30:34 2009

Starting background process MMON

Sun May 31 08:33:19 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

Sun May 31 08:33:21 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

Sun May 31 08:33:21 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

Sun May 31 08:33:21 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

Sun May 31 08:33:21 2009

Errors in file /oracle/oms/admin/JTOMS/udump/jtoms_ora_1396852.trc:

ORA-00600: internal error code, arguments: [2103], [0], [0], [1], [900], [], [], []

 

 

二、

这里我们顺便来看一下,关于ora-00600[2103]的一些处理办法:

其中有一种是会造成instance crash,如下:ITPUB个人空间`D­Z_F%Fla
ORA-00600:internalerrorcode,arguments:[2103], [1], [0], [1], [900], [], [], []
#D‑W"g
C y;r(o0
   LGWR: Detected ARCH process failureITPUB
个人空间(q3QJr(vO9_-Z T
   LGWR: Detected ARCH process failureITPUB
个人空间0PH&L)bSC\‑v
   LGWR: STARTING ARCH PROCESSES

这里是由于bug6520821(unpublished)所引起的错误,主要是在做alter database backup controlfile ...
6HO*`,~@2_0
所引起的bug,针对这个bug,oracle目前没有提供opatch,但是10202patchset修复了这个bug.ITPUB个人空间#rx8\ \ f._
因此在9208上遇到这个bug,可以不做alter database backup ....这样的操作,因此要注意你ITPUB个人空间h s-l?tN n
备份策略的设置.


_oo8r M0
第二种情况是:

oracle进程会由于获取CF(controlfile enqueue)时间太长而导致超时造成的.
T0u j
Z2F)E#~6g0
主要原因有:ITPUB个人空间J%J3S%oEo&I9P5U
由于IO子系统速率过于低下,当然通常这种情况都是由于存储故障所导致,如控制器链路故障ITPUB个人空间P8G3L"uvvLe
以及接交换机链路出现问题都会导致IO出现问题,这时候ITPUB个人空间


n'm
y1nZ

os
故障.ITPUB个人空间n JSV[1]o"d2]6}
AIO
多个写进程导致,这里可以考虑设置max_io_servermin_io_server至一个合适的值.
2k Z)|#J2_t


n0日志切换过于频繁,或者日志文件过小以及日志组太少.
T-q;`.c&qt!a8h0
使用隐含参数来控制超时时间,:ITPUB
个人空间x#Bh.T!@}[1]\ x

_CONTROLFILE_ENQUEUE_TIMEOUT = 10800

当然,可能会有一些情况这里没有一一列出.这里只是作为2103错误的一个参考和解决的思路.

三、这里确定为存储问题

 重启了HP 存储EVA的控制台系统,数据库、以及数据库备份正常。

转:http://space.itpub.net/12778571/viewspace-604543

来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/653972/viewspace-611273/,如需转载,请注明出处,否则将追究法律责任。

下一篇: 没有了~
请登录后发表评论 登录
全部评论

注册时间:2008-09-17

  • 博文量
    15
  • 访问量
    22822